Chapter 4

Who was he playing the devoted brother for now?

"Don't worry. I know where my place is. Uncle Vittorio arranged it, so you do as the old Don says. I won't make trouble over it."

"Go on. See to your business. I'll wait for you back at the Estate."

He let out a breath, then flagged down a car himself and sent me home in it.

And turned around to take Adriana to the dressmaker.

Mother and Uncle Vittorio already knew Adriana was coming to the house.

They'd had the kitchen going since noon, the whole place thick with garlic and simmering sauce, the way it always smelled before a Sunday sit-down.

The moment Lorenzo walked in with Adriana on his arm.

The two of them pressed an envelope into her hands together, a hundred thousand in tribute, laid out for all the inner circle to witness who was being honored under that roof.

I made the excuse that I wasn't feeling well and shut myself in my room.

But Lorenzo came in carrying a gift box.

As he fastened the bracelet around my wrist, he drew a blue rose from inside his coat, still warm from his body.

Dropped to one knee on the floor.

His eyes full of devotion.

"I know being with me, with no real title, no name to stand on, has made you suffer. But after the wedding, I'll still be your brother, and I'll still live here, keeping you company just like before."

"Kate, don't be angry with me, okay?"

I looked down at the Hermès emblem stamped into the leather.

It was the exact trinket that came free with that handbag of Adriana's.

"Fine. I won't be angry with you."

"Go eat. They've had it ready a long time."

The sounds of congratulations kept drifting up from downstairs, the low warmth of men who knew which way the Family's favor ran.

Mother stood beside the table, smoothing the front of her dress with both hands, fidgeting like one of the servants.

Lorenzo ordered her around as if it were the most natural thing in the world, telling her to bring the dishes, to ladle out the soup. A woman who'd married into the Falcone blood, reduced to carrying plates for the son of the man who was supposed to be her husband.

Everything I'd swallowed down these past years erupted from my chest.

I gathered up every gift he'd given me over these six years, and threw them all into the trash.

The moment the trash can tipped over, Adriana suddenly appeared in the doorway.

Looking at the mess on the floor, she raised a smug smile.

"What, you can't even handle this much?"

"Caterina, you're even more useless than I thought."

"Then again, what could a homewrecker's daughter ever amount to? Watching your own mother scurry around like a maid, not even allowed a seat at the table. That must be agony, isn't it?"

I looked at her coldly.

"What are you trying to say?"

Adriana's lips curled into a mocking smile.

She pulled out her phone, opened her messages with Lorenzo, and waved the screen in front of me.

"Oh, that's right. You don't know yet, do you? Every night, the way you and Lorenzo get close. He sends all of it to me to look at."

"If these videos landed on your mother's phone, wouldn't she just lose her mind on the spot?"

"One's her own flesh-and-blood daughter, the other's her stepson from her second marriage, and the two of you carrying on night after night behind their backs. In this Family, that kind of thing gets people buried."

"Don't you dare!"

I couldn't hold back the fury in my chest any longer.

I swung my hand and slapped her across the face.

The crisp sound rang out, and for a half-second the whole house went still.

Adriana dropped to the floor, shattering a glass photo frame beneath her. Her too-bright cry cut off a beat too fast.

Blood instantly welled up from her palm.

Lorenzo rushed in and gathered her into his arms.

The look he turned on me was full of rage.

"Caterina, what are you doing? Have you lost your mind?"

"Adriana came up here to call you down to eat. What the hell has gotten into you?"

Uncle Vittorio's face went cold beside them. He set his glass of grappa down on the sideboard, slow and deliberate, the way he did before he said something no one could take back.

Mother hurried to explain, her voice thin with panic, her hands smoothing her dress again and again:

"Kate didn't mean it. There's some misunderstanding here, that's all."

"Kate, apologize to Adriana. Now."

Adriana, eyes red, pressed herself into Lorenzo's arms.

"I'm sorry, I only came to invite Kate to our wedding. I don't know why she suddenly hit me."

"Don't blame Kate. She didn't mean it either."

A cold smile curved at the corner of my mouth as I stared straight at the two of them clinging together.

He ignored my expression, his eyes full of icy hatred.

"Caterina, apologize!"

My nails dug deep into my palms, blood sliding down drop by drop. My other hand had gone very still around the thin silver band on my finger, and I did not let go of it.
